[Detailed description of the invention] This invention is a nuclear fuel storage system installed between a transfer cavity and a fuel storage pit, which transports nuclear fuel into a nuclear reactor in a containment vessel, and transports spent nuclear fuel from a nuclear reactor to a fuel storage pit. This relates to a transfer device.

As shown in FIG. 1, the conventional nuclear fuel transfer system is provided with a fuel transfer pipe 6 and a gate valve 7 on a partition wall c between a fuel storage pit a filled with shielding water and a transfer cavity b on the reactor containment vessel side. , on running rails 2, 3, and 4 laid in series within the fuel transfer pit a, the fuel transfer pipe 6, and the transfer cavity b,
A fuel transfer truck 1 having a plurality of wheels 5 and running with a fuel container (not shown) mounted thereon is mounted, and the fuel transfer truck 1 is driven by a drive mechanism (not shown) provided on the side of the fuel storage pit a. It is designed to transfer nuclear fuel underwater by moving it back and forth, and when the transfer is completed or an accident occurs, the fuel storage pit a.
The fuel transfer trolley 1 is housed inside the tank, and the fuel transfer pipe 6 is closed by a gate valve 7 to isolate the transfer cavity b and the fuel storage pit a. The gate valve 7 cannot be closed when the fuel transfer trolley 1 is in the position shown in the figure and cannot be operated due to an electrical system or mechanical failure, or when there is no time for repairs, etc. An emergency truck moving mechanism for moving the fuel transfer truck 1 into the fuel storage pit a is also provided.

In the conventional example of the emergency trolley moving mechanism, as shown in FIGS. 1 and 2A and B, an emergency pull-out wire (cable wire) 8 is run from the working surface side of the fuel storage pit a through a sheave 8a. In addition to being arranged along the rail 2, the tip fitting 10 provided at the tip of the extraction wire 8 can be separated into a mounting fitting 11 provided on the side of the truck frame 12 supported on the floor of the fuel transfer pit 2 via legs. A locking fitting 1a, which is connected to the lower side of the fuel transfer truck 1 and into which the pull-out wire 8 is loosely inserted, is configured to lock onto the tip fitting 10, and a hook 9 provided at the upper end of the pull-out wire 8 is connected to the top fitting 10.
is strongly pulled by a winch crane or the like (not shown), the end fitting 10 is removed from the mounting fitting 11, and the pull-out wire 8 is pulled to move the fuel transfer trolley 1 from the illustrated position into the fuel storage pit a. ing.

However, as shown in FIG. 2, the emergency cart moving mechanism in the conventional nuclear fuel transfer device moves the terminal fitting 10c, which is connected to the fork end 10a of the tip fitting 10 by the pin 10b, to the truck frame 1.
The pin 11a is connected to the mounting bracket 11 fixed on the second side, and the terminal fitting 10c of the tip fitting 10 is strongly pulled through the lead wire 8, and the pin 11a is connected to the mounting fitting 11 fixed on the second side.
Since the pin 11a is separated by shearing, fragments of the sheared pin 11a are scattered and mixed into the drive mechanism of the fuel transfer truck 1, etc., and there is a risk that they will be damaged and malfunction.

The present invention relates to an idea to eliminate the above-mentioned drawbacks of conventional nuclear fuel transfer devices, and involves reciprocating fuel underwater between a transfer cavity and a fuel storage pit through a fuel transfer pipe having a gate valve provided in the bulkhead. A transfer trolley is provided, and a lead-out wire having a tip fitting that is inserted through a locking fitting provided on the fuel transfer cart and is locked to the locking fitting is disposed along a running rail of the fuel transfer cart, In a nuclear fuel transfer device in which a tip fitting is separably connected to a mounting fitting of a truck frame in a fuel storage pit, the fitting is provided with a spring joint mechanism consisting of a spring plate piece that fits and snaps the tip fitting. The feature is that the end fitting of the emergency extraction wire is separably connected to the mounting bracket on the truck frame side by a spring joint mechanism, so that the end fitting of the extraction wire can be disconnected when the connection is separated. The object of the present invention is to provide a nuclear fuel transfer device that does not generate fragments or the like.

The present invention has the above-mentioned configuration, in which the lead-out wire is arranged along the traveling rail of the fuel transfer truck, and the end fitting of the lead-out wire that is latched to the fuel transfer cart is attached to the mounting bracket on the truck frame side. They are separably connected by a spring joint mechanism, so when the pull-out wire is pulled, the end fitting of the pull-out wire is easily separated from the mounting bracket on the truck frame side by the spring joint mechanism, and the tip fitting is connected to the fuel transfer truck. It is possible to lock and move the same truck, and during the separation, cut pieces etc. are not scattered and damage to the drive mechanism etc. does not occur.

The illustrated embodiment is constructed as described above and includes a fuel transfer cavity b as shown in FIG.
When the fuel transfer cart 1 on the side cannot be moved to the fuel storage pit a side by a normal drive mechanism (not shown), or when it is urgently necessary to move the same, When the pull-out wire 8 is pulled in the same manner as described in FIG. 1, the tip fitting 20
The pins 20b and 21a of the mounting bracket 21 are not sheared, and the spring plate 21d of the terminal fitting 21b on the mounting bracket 21 side is deformed outward by its elasticity, and the fitting head 20d on the end fitting 20 side is In order to come out of the fitting hole 21c, the tip end fitting 20 is separated from the mounting fitting 20 side at the spring joint mechanism portion.

Therefore, the locking fitting 1a on the side of the fuel transfer truck 1 is locked to the tip fitting 20, and the fuel transfer truck 1 can be urgently moved into the fuel storage pit a by the pull-out wire 8, and the partition shown in FIG. By closing the valve 7, it becomes possible to shut off the transfer cavity b and the fuel storage pit a, and it is possible to take measures such as investigating the cause of the accident.

In addition, as described above, the tip fitting 20 and the mounting fitting 2
1 are connected to each other by the above-mentioned spring joint mechanism, and when they are separated, no shearing of the members occurs, so there is no scattering of fragments, etc., and the integrity of the moving mechanism etc. is improved. Further, as described above, the tip fitting 20 and the mounting fitting 21 are not damaged and can be reused as they are, and the reconnection operation can be performed extremely easily.
